Don’t wait for a better day, a better holiday, or a great achievement. Today is an achievement and a chance to live a life in itself. Be beautiful, and don’t wait for today to live happily. Accept it before you begin. The moment you wake up, be grateful for this new day.
The first hour of the day should be devoted to physical and mental health. Walking, exercise, Tsuranayama, yoga, meditation, drinking water, and going to the park.
Set a time to wake up, and make sure you get out of bed after one second and don’t come back until late at night. Wake up at the same time every day, even if you don’t have anything important to finish.
